1.INTRODUCTION

THIS FIRE ALARM CONTROL PANEL IS CLASS 1 EQUIPMENT AND MUST BE
EARTHED
This equipment must be installed and maintained by a qualified and technically experienced person.

1.1 HANDLING THE PCBS

If the PCBs are to be removed to ease fitting the enclosure and cables, care must be taken to
avoid damage by static.
The best method is to wear an earth strap, but touching any earth point (eg building plumbing) will help to
discharge any static. Hold PCBs by their sides, avoiding contact with any components.
Always handle PCBs by their sides and avoid touching the legs of any components. Keep the PCBs away from
damp dirty areas, e.g. in a small cardboard box.

1.3 ABOUT THE PREMIER AD FIRE ALARM PANEL & INTEGRAL PSE
• The PREMIER AD Fire alarm control panel is a
two loop analogue addressable Fire Alarm
Control Panel, with the loops split into 16 Zones.
• It has 4 sounder output circuits each capable of
supplying 250mA.
• It has a set of fire relay contacts (voltage free) rated
at 1A SELV.
• It has a set of fault relay contacts (voltage free)
rated at 1A SELV. This relay is normally
powered to allow a fault output in the case of
total power failure.
• It has a class change connection to allow remote
activation of the sounders. (not required by
EN54-2)
• It has an RS485 repeater connection.
• It has the ability to disable any address, any zone
or any of the sounder circuits.
• It has a one man test mode, which resets the zone
in test after 8 seconds.(EN54 option with
requirements).

1.4 DESIGNING THE SYSTEM

This manual is not designed to teach Fire Alarm System design. It is assumed that the System has
been designed by a competent person, and that the installer has an understanding of Fire Alarm
System components and their use.
We strongly recommend consultation with a suitably qualified, competent person regarding the
design of the Fire Alarm System. The System must be commissioned and serviced in accordance
with our instructions and the relevant National Standards. Contact the Fire Officer concerned with
the property at an early stage in case he has any special requirements.
If in doubt, read BS 5839: Pt 1: 2002 "Fire Detection and Alarm Systems for buildings (Code of
Practice for System Design, Installation, commissioning and maintenance)" available from the BSI, or
at your local reference library.
